An educational experience outside the usual environment
At the Colegio Internacional de Granada, we understand that learning is not limited to the classroom; it must be expanded through real-world experiences that connect students with the academic and professional spheres. For this reason, this past Tuesday, our 2nd-year Bachillerato students visited the Escuela Internacional de Gerencia (International School of Management), an activity designed to broaden their perspective on the various educational alternatives available to them after graduation.
Discovering New Options for the Future
During the visit, students attended an informative talk where they learned firsthand about the different training programs offered by this institution. These types of encounters are especially valuable at a stage when students must make important decisions about their future, as it allows them to explore potential paths and reflect with better judgment on their personal and academic interests. At our school in Granada, we place great importance on this academic orientation process.
Learning Through Practice
In addition to the informative session, students participated in workshops related to marketing and market competition. These activities allowed them to experience concepts that are typically studied from a theoretical perspective, encouraging more active, participatory, and meaningful learning. Experiencing these subjects through practice helps consolidate knowledge and sparks interest in areas linked to the business world.
